I just have a quick question:  I figured out how, in Setup, on my home
computer to have the first boot device be the DVD-ROM drive.  I put the
Win2K Pro disk in but nothing happened.  I turned off computer, and, again,
nothing happened.

Is there something I am missing, by any chance?   Was hoping for some
guidance on figuring out what I'm doing wrong.

Sounds like you did it right.

Possibly the cd is dirty or scratched...
possibly a bad cdrom.

If you are sure the cdrom and cd are ok...
you can put the cd in another machine and make a set of win2k installation
floppies (There will be 4 total)

Then try using the floppies...

Some machines can be stubborn and just plain not boot from the cd
